A method of forming a stator for a positive displacement motor. The method includes forming a liner that includes at least two resilient layers and at least one fiber layer, and the at least two resilient layers are positioned so as to enclose the at least one fiber layer. The liner is positioned in a stator tube, and the stator tube includes a shaped inner surface including at least two radially inwardly projecting lobes extending helically along a selected length of the stator tube. The liner is cured in the stator tube so that the liner conforms to the radially inwardly projecting lobes formed on the inner surface and to the helical shape of the inner surface. The curing forms a bond between the liner and the inner surface and between the at least two resilient layers and the at least one fiber layer.
